3.Recent advances on cancer-associated fibroblasts treatment strategies and delivery systems
Shi-jun YUAN ; Yong-jun LIU ; Na ZHANG
Acta Pharmaceutica Sinica 2022;57(3):638-643
A large number of cancer-associated fibroblasts (CAFs) in tumor tissues create a favorable environment for the development of tumor. CAFs inhibit immune cells activation and viability by cytokine secretion, and CAFs prohibit drugs and immune cells infiltration by producing extracellular matrix to weaken cancer treatment efficacy. Regulating CAFs or overcoming CAFs barriers are new strategies for cancer therapy. Hence, designing nano-carriers for regulating CAFs to suppress tumor progression or promoting drug delivery to tumor site by overcoming CAFs barriers has attracted much attention. Therefore, this manuscript reviewed the recent progresses of nano-carriers for CAFs-targeting cancer therapies, in order to provide a reference for clinical cancer treatment.

5.Expression and purification of four single-stranded DNA-binding proteins and their binding on HCV RNA.
Hai-Yan SHI ; Yong-Jun LI ; Ji-Min GAO
Chinese Journal of Experimental and Clinical Virology 2013;27(5):354-356
OBJECTIVEExpress and purify four single-stranded DNA-binding (SSB) proteins, and evaluate the binding of SSB proteins on HCV RNA.
METHODSThe expression plasmids of four SSB proteins were conducted, termed TTH, SSOB, KOD and BL21, respectively. The BL21 (DE3) was transformed by the expression plasmid of TTH, Transetta (DE3) were transformed by the expression plasmid of SSOB, KOD and BL21, then protein expression was induced with IPTG, the expression products were analysised by SDS-PAGE. To evaluate the binding of SSB on HCV RNA, RNA-SSB protein complexes were applied to a 1.2% TAE agarose gel.
RESULTSSuitable competent cells were transformed with the expression plasmids, induced by IPTG. SSB proteins were purified by affinity chromatography, to visualize their purity all SSB proteins were applied to SDS-PAGE analysis. All four proteins showed single clear bands. We have successfully obtained the SSB protein expression plasmid, expressed and purified SSB protein. TAE agarose gel electrophoresis was used to confirm SSB protein-RNA binding activity. The each of SSB-RNA complex migrated more slowly than the sole RNA, which suggested SSB protein could specifically bind to RNA.
CONCLUSIONSWe have expressed and purified four SSB proteins, and for the first time found that SSB protein can bind HCV RNA. Our results may provide a basis for future studies of the novel functions of SSB proteins on RNA.

6.Clinical study of surgery treatment for low grade gliomas with epilepsia as main symptom located near eloquent brain regions
Yan ZHAN ; Quanhong SHI ; Yong ZENG ; Fujian ZOU ; Yong JIANG ; Jun XUE ; Rongzhou CUI
Chongqing Medicine 2013;(27):3239-3241
Objective To explore the guidance significance of the functional MRI and DTI (fMRI ,DTI) ,intraoperative ultra-sound(IOUS) ,neuronavigation ,electrocorticography(EcoG) monitoring used in surgical treatment of low-grade gliomas with epi-lepsy as main symptom located near the eloquent brain regions .Methods 23 neurosurgical patients in the First Affiliated Hospital of Chongqing Medical University during 2009-2010 were performed the retrospective analysis .The preoperative fMRI ,DTI deter-mined the positional relation between the lesions with the conduction bundle and the eloquent brain regions ,the electrophysiological and imageological examinations positioned the epileptogenic focus and lesions ,the MRI-mediated neuronavigation system was adopt-ed to formulate the surgical plan and choose the best surgical approach ,IOUS was used to perform the realtime monitoring for pre-cisely positioning the lesion range and determining the extent of resection ,and the intraoperative EcoG was adopted to determine the epileptogenic focus localization ,the lesions and the epileptogenic focus was dealed by the operating microscope for avoiding the func-tional region ,and the patient′s prognosis was evaluated and recored in detail after operation .Results By the precisely positioning the lesions and epileptogenic focus by fMRI ,DTI ,neuronavigation and ultrasound ,the lesion resection degrees by the operative mi-croscope and intraopertaive pathological guidance were 17 cases of Ⅰ-Ⅱ grade ,4 cases of Ⅲ grade and 2 case of Ⅳ-Ⅴ grade .1 case of motor aphasia ,4 cases of hemiplegia and monoplegia and 1 case of disturbance of consciousness after operation were improved by the treatment of neurotrophy ,dehydration and hyperbaric oxygen and discharged from hospital with rehabilitation .No death case occurred .The evaluation of the life quality :20 cases ofⅠ-Ⅱ grade ,3 cases of Ⅲ grade and no vegetable survival case of Ⅳ grade . The evaluation of resection clinical effect :20 cases of cure ,3 cases of improvement ,no case of as before and exacerbation .After fol-lowed up for 6-24 months ,according to Engel classification of seizure efficacy assessment :Ⅰ-Ⅱ grade in 21 cases ,Ⅲ grade in 2 case ,no case of Ⅳgrade .Conclusion fMRI ,DTI ,neuronavigation ,IOUS and EcoG for guiding the operation of low grade gliomas located near the eloquent brain regions can resect the lesion to the largest extent and simultaneously deal with epileptogenic focus , effectively protect the neurological function of the functional region ,greatly reduce the side-injury of the normal brain tissues in the functional region ,at the same time increase the curative effect of symptomatic epilepsy .
7.Effect and safety of testosterone undecanoate in the treatment of late-onset hypogonadism: a meta-analysis.
Yi ZHENG ; Xu-bo SHEN ; Yuan-zhong ZHOU ; Jia MA ; Xue-jun SHANG ; Yong-jun SHI
National Journal of Andrology 2015;21(3):263-271
OBJECTIVETo evaluate the efficacy and safety of testosterone undecanoate (TU) in the treatment of late-onset hypogonadism (LOH) by meta-analysis.
METHODSWe searched Pubmed (until April 1, 2014), Embase (until March 28, 2014), Cochrane Library (until April 17, 2014), CBM (from January 1, 2001 to February 2, 2014), CNKI (from January 1, 2001 to February 2, 2014), Wanfang Database (from January 1, 2000 to February 2, 2014), and VIP Database (from January 1, 2000 to Febru ary 2, 2014) for randomized controlled trials of TU for the treatment of LOH. We evaluated the quality of the identified literature and performed meta-analysis on the included studies using the Rveman5. 2 software.
RESULTSTotally, 14 studies were included after screening, which involved 1 686 cases. Compared with the placebo and blank control groups, TU treatment significantly increased the levels of serum total testosterone (SMD = 6.22, 95% CI 3.99 to 8.45, P < 0.05) and serum free testosterone (SMD = 4.35, 95% CI 1.86 to 6. 85, P < 0.05) but decreased the contents of luteinizing hormone (WMD = -2.23, 95% CI -4.03 to -0.42, P < 0.05), sex hormone binding globulin (WMD = 2.00, 95% CI 1.38 to 2.63, P < 0.05). TU also remarkably reduced the scores of Partial Androgen Deficiency of the Aging Males (WMD = -9.49, 95% CI -12.96 to -6.03, P < 0.05) and Aging Males Symptoms rating scale (WMD = -2.76, 95% CI -4.85 to -0.66, P <0.05) but increased the hemoglobin level (SMD = 2.35, 95% CI 0.29 to 4.41, P < 0.05) and packed-cell volume (SMD = 4.35, 95% CI 1.36 to 7.33, P < 0.05). However, no significant changes were shown in aspertate aminotransferase, alanine transaminase, prostate-specific antigen, or prostate volume after TU treatment (P > 0.05).
CONCLUSIONTU could significantly increase the serum testosterone level and improve the clinical symptoms of LOH patients without inducing serious adverse reactions. However, due to the limited number and relatively low quality of the included studies, the above conclusion could be cautiously applied to clinical practice.

8.A systematic review of intravenous immunoglobulin for critical hand-foot-mouth disease
Shaodong ZHAO ; Jun CHEN ; Xuhua GE ; Yong LIU ; Jun SHI ; Qin ZHANG ; Wenliang YU
Chinese Journal of Applied Clinical Pediatrics 2015;30(22):1716-1720
Objective To evaluate the effectiveness of intravenous immunoglobulin (IVIG) in critical hand-foot-mouth disease (HFMD).Methods The data from PubMed, MEDLINE, EMBASE, EBSChost, Cochrane Library, Cochrane Central Register of Controlled Trials, Ovid, China Biology Medicine disc, Wanfang Data, China National Knowledge Infrastructure, Chinese Citation Database, and other references and grey literatures were retrieved, screening out all those related to clinical trials on treating critical HFMD by IVIG.Standard methods of the Cochrane Collaboration were employed to evaluate the methodological quality of the trials.Meta analysis was performed with Rev man 5.3 software.Results Eleven trials including 967 cases were investigated.The meta analysis showed that IVIG had significantly clinical efficacy (OR =6.84,95% CI:3.74-12.52 ,P < 0.05).IVIG could significantly decrease duration of fever (MD =-1.94,95% CI:-3.07--0.81 ,P <0.05) ,hospitalization time (MD =-4.56,95% CI:-8.95--0.17,P <0.05).There was no significant difference in duration of fever (MD =-0.28,95 % CI:-0.59-0.03, P > 0.05), duration of herpes (MD =0.18,95% CI:-0.22-0.59, P > 0.05), hospitalization time (MD =-0.12,95% CI:-0.47-0.23, P > 0.05) when the dosage of injection was adjusted.Conclusions IVIG is recommended for treating critical HFMD because it is effective in decreasing the duration of fever and hospitalization.Well designed studies with more sample in multi-center are required in further study to explore the efficacy and safety of IVIG on critical HFMD.
9.Analysis of the Basic Stress Pathway Above Acetabular Dome.
Yong NIE ; Jun MA ; Qiang HAUNG ; Qinsheng HU ; Xiaojun SHI ; Fuxing PEI
Journal of Biomedical Engineering 2015;32(4):802-807
The basic stress pathway above the acetabular dome is important for the maintenance of implant stability in acetabular reconstruction of total hip arthroplasty (THA). The purpose of this study was to describe the basic stress pathway to provide evidence for clinical acetabular reconstruction guidance of THA. A subject-specific finite element (FE) model was developed from CT data to generate 3 normal hip models and a convergence study was conducted to determine the number of pelvic trabecular bone material properties using 5 material assignment plans. In addition, in the range of 0 to 20 mm above the acetabular dome, the models were sectioned and the stress pathway was defined as two parts, i.e., 3D, trabecular bone stress distribution and quantified cortical bone stress level. The results showed that using 100 materials to define the material property of pelvic trabecular bone could assure both the accuracy and efficiency of the FE model. Under the same body weight condition, the 3D trabecular bone stress distributions above the acetabular dome were consistent, and especially the quantified cortical bone stress levels were all above 20 MPa and showed no statistically significant difference (P>0.05). Therefore, defining the basic stress pathway above the acetabular dome under certain body weight condition contributes to design accurate preoperative plan for acetabular reconstruction, thus helping restore the normal hip biomechanics and preserve the stability of the implants.

10.Anti-dementia effect of Tongluo Xingnao effervescent tablet based on urinary metabonomics.
Jiang-ping WEI ; Yin-jie ZHANG ; Yun-tong MA ; Shi-jun XU ; Yong-yan WANG
China Journal of Chinese Materia Medica 2015;40(16):3287-3292
Tongluo Xingnao effervescent tablet (TLXNET) is a patented prescription, which comes from modified Xionggui decoction and can improve cognitive function. However, its effect on the urine metabolites and anti-dementia mechanism in the dementia model rats induced by hippocampal injection with Aβ25-35 remains unclear. The experiment focused on the changes in trajectory and inter-relationship among the urinary metabolite of rats in the blank group, Aβ25-35 hippocampal injection dementia model group and the TLXNET intervention group, in order to determine theirs characteristic metabolic markers and explain the anti-dementia effect of TLX-NET base on the change of metabolic trajectory of these bio-markers. According to the experimental results, 5, 6-indolequinone, 4-hydroxyphenyl pyruvic acid (4-HPPA), cortisol and 3-thiosulfate lactic were preliminarily identified as the characteristic metabolic markers. They mainly participate in dopamine system, glucocorticoids and energy metabolic pathways. TLXNET can apparently downregulate the disturbances of metabolic trajectory of the four bio-markers. The experiment indicates that the dementia model induced by injecting Aβ25-3 into hippocampus has its characteristic endogenous metabolic markers in urine, and ELXNET can ameliorate dementia by down-regulating the disturbances of metabolic trajectory.
